Integrated Telecom Company (ITC) and King Abdulaziz City for Science and Technology (KACST) represented by the Internet Services Unit launched an initiative to increase the capacity of connectivity service between universities and academic bodies to more than 12 GB free of charge. This comes as part of the strategic partnership between the ITC and KACST and in accordance with the directives of CITC.

The initiative aims to facilitate the educational process confirmed to be continued through E-learning and distance education, and as part of ITC national and social responsibilities to provide full support to all procedures and precautions done by Saudi Government to prevent the spread of Coronavirus (COVID 19). The initiative also aims to support university students and faculties to improve the quality of the virtual classes and educational platforms and optimize the access to national digital services.

In this regard, Eng. Osama Ibrahim Al-Dosary, CEO of Integrated Telecom Company said, “we at ITC value our strategic partnership with KACST and are always looking to cooperate to reinforce digital transformation initiatives in the Kingdom”.
